WebReduction by electrolysis. This is a common extraction process for the more reactive metals - for example, for aluminium and metals above it in the electrochemical series. You may also come across it in other cases such as one method of extracting copper and in the purification of copper. During electrolysis, electrons are being added directly ... WebSolution. High reactive metals such as aluminium, calcium and sodium are extracted from their ores by the electrolytic reduction. These highly reactive metals cannot be reduced by using carbon as it is less reactive. In this method the electric current is passed through the ores to get the pure metals. portlandia credits https://mckenney-martinson.com

WebThe ores of less reactive metals like copper and mercury are placed at the bottom of the reactivity series. Metals are extracted from these ores by heating them alone. We … WebRoasting is the process of heating to a high temperature below the melting point of metal in presence of air or oxygen. Generally roasting is utilized to convert sulphide ores to respective oxides. Extraction of metals of low reactivity: Mercury is a metal of low reactivity. Cinnabar is the sulphide ore of mercury and its chemical formula is HgS.
